Opportunity Spotlight: Assessment Officer - Community Support Service

Are you a driven and compassionate individual seeking to make a tangible difference in people's lives? This Assessment Officer role within our CQC-rated 'Outstanding' Community Support Service presents a compelling opportunity for career growth and personal fulfillment.

At the heart of this role is empowering individuals to regain their independence through a reablement approach, offering short-term recovery and support. You'll be instrumental in helping people rebuild essential life skills and confidence following illness or injury, enabling them to live as independently as possible. This collaborative environment fosters strong partnerships with health, social work, and voluntary sector colleagues, ensuring a holistic and integrated approach to customer care.
